Your buddy has the ball at X.
Instead of awkwardly taking up space, make a decision. One thing you can do is a fish hook cut.
Act like you’re creating space and getting out of the way, and slowly drag your defender with you.
Then, cut back HARD with your stick up!

How to V-Hold 📝
A v-hold can be a defender’s best friend or a reason they got beat. Learn to use it effectively and it’s a great tool to disrupt shots and passes as dodger’s go to your cross hand side.

“Approach to Show Adjacent” Drill
1. Approach top center player with good defensive posture
2. Hedge to adjacent player without opening chest to ball watch
3. Find the passing lane back to top center player
4. Arrive back to your player in good approach form as the ball arrives
